Output e7073d5c28f9265f9a28581d87a57b6ad652effcec9a9d08b2491c58f89a8215:0

value
5680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fd273f341e81a8226e25801d14f26f1c2bb8e66 OP_EQUALVERIFY OP_CHECKSIG
address
LfdR4WwzFg8ZCMrg56TxfTVpi3nJ7YNWPS
transaction
e7073d5c28f9265f9a28581d87a57b6ad652effcec9a9d08b2491c58f89a8215
spent
true